Underwritten Shelf Offering Sample Clauses

An Underwritten Shelf Offering clause outlines the process by which a company can issue securities from a pre-registered shelf registration statement with the assistance of underwriters. This clause typically details the roles and responsibilities of the underwriters, the procedures for pricing and selling the securities, and any conditions that must be met before the offering can proceed. By establishing a clear framework for conducting these offerings, the clause enables the company to efficiently access capital markets as needed, while ensuring that the interests of both the issuer and the underwriters are protected.
Underwritten Shelf Offering. The Holders may, by written notice to the Company, elect to sell some or all of the Registrable Securities registered pursuant to a Shelf Registration Statement, in an offering amount not to be less than Fifty Million Dollars ($50,000,000) of Registrable Securities, in the form of an underwritten offering under the Shelf Registration Statement (an “Underwritten Shelf Offering”); provided, that (i) the Company shall not be obligated to effect more than an aggregate of six (6) underwritten offerings under this Section 2.1(c) and Section 2.2; and (ii) the Company shall not be obligated to effect an underwritten offering more than once per quarter. For the avoidance of doubt, the Holders may make an unlimited number of sales under any Shelf Registration Statement that are not underwritten offerings. Any request for an Underwritten Shelf Offering will specify the number of shares of Registrable Securities proposed to be sold and will also specify the intended method of disposition thereof (which may include a Block Trade or an Overnight Underwritten Offering). The Company shall select the Underwriter or Underwriters in connection with any such Underwritten Shelf Offering; provided that such Underwriter or Underwriters must be reasonably satisfactory to the Holders. Unless the Company and each Holder shall consent in writing, no party, other than a Holder, shall be permitted to offer securities in connection with any such Underwritten Shelf Offering.
Underwritten Shelf Offering. Any Holder of then-outstanding Registrable Securities may determine to commence on Underwritten Offering off of the Shelf Registration (“Underwritten Shelf Offering”). Any such Holder and the Company shall enter into an underwriting agreement in customary form with the Underwriter(s) selected for such Underwritten Shelf Offering by the Holder initiating such Underwritten Shelf Offering (provided that such investment banker or bankers and managers shall be reasonably satisfactory to the Company). The Holder initiating the Underwritten Shelf Offering shall have the right, after consultation with the Company, to determine the plan of distribution, including the price at which the Registrable Securities are to be sold and the underwriting commissions, discounts and fees.
Underwritten Shelf Offering. If a sale of Registrable Securities pursuant to this Section 2.3 involves an underwritten offering and the applicable securities are to be distributed on a firm commitment basis by or through one or more underwriters of recognized standing under underwriting terms appropriate for such transaction, then, within five (5) business days of the Company’s receipt of a Shelf Takedown Notice pursuant to Section 2.3(b), the Company shall give written notice to each Holder who has elected to be included in the Shelf Registration Statement informing such Holder of the Company’s intent to file such Shelf Takedown Prospectus Supplement with the SEC and of such Holder’s right to request the addition of such Holder’s Registrable Securities to such Shelf Takedown Prospectus Supplement. The Company shall, subject to the provisions of Section 2.7(b) and this Section 2.3(c), include in such Shelf Takedown Prospectus Supplement all Registrable Securities of each such Holder with respect to which the Company receives a written request for inclusion therein within five (5) business days after the notice contemplated by the immediately preceding sentence is given to the Holders.

Underwritten Shelf Offering. (a) At any time that the Shelf Registration Statement is effective, if Investor delivers a notice to Parent stating that it intends to sell all or part of its Registrable Securities included by it on the Shelf Registration Statement in a non-marketed (no customary “road show” or substantial marketing efforts) underwritten offering (a “Non-Marketed Shelf Offering”), then, Parent shall amend or supplement the Shelf Registration Statement as may be necessary in order to enable such Registrable Securities to be distributed pursuant to the Non-Marketed Shelf Offering. (b) Parent shall have no obligation to effect more than two (2) Non-Marketed Shelf Offerings under this Section 2.3. (c) Investor shall select the investment banking firm or firms to act as the lead underwriter or underwriters in connection with any Non-Marketed Shelf Offering, subject to consultation with and prior written approval from Parent. No holder of Registrable Securities may participate in any Non- Marketed Shelf Offering under this Section 2.3 unless such holder (i) agrees to sell the Registrable Securities it desires to include in the Non-Marketed Shelf Offering on the basis provided in any underwriting arrangements in customary form and (ii) completes and executes all questionnaires, powers of attorney, indemnities, lock-up agreements, underwriting agreements and other documents required under the terms of such underwriting arrangements.

  • Requests for Underwritten Shelf Takedowns Following the expiration of the applicable Lock-Up Period, at any time and from time to time when an effective Shelf is on file with the Commission, any Holder or the Sponsor (any of the Holders or the Sponsor, a “Demanding Holder”) may request to sell all or any portion of its Registrable Securities in an Underwritten Offering or other coordinated offering that is registered pursuant to the Shelf (each, an “Underwritten Shelf Takedown”); provided that the Company shall only be obligated to effect an Underwritten Shelf Takedown if such offering shall include Registrable Securities proposed to be sold by the Demanding Holder, either individually or together with other Demanding Holders, with a total offering price reasonably expected to exceed, in the aggregate, $25 million (the “Minimum Takedown Threshold”). All requests for Underwritten Shelf Takedowns shall be made by giving written notice to the Company, which shall specify the approximate number of Registrable Securities proposed to be sold in the Underwritten Shelf Takedown. The Company shall have the right to select the Underwriters for such offering (which shall consist of one or more reputable nationally recognized investment banks), subject to the initial Demanding Holder’s prior approval (which shall not be unreasonably withheld, conditioned or delayed). The Holders, collectively, on the one hand, and the Sponsor, on the other hand, may each demand Underwritten Shelf Takedowns pursuant to this Section 2.1.5 (i) not more than two times in any 12-month period (the “Yearly Limit”) and (ii) not more than five times in the aggregate (the “Total Limit”). Notwithstanding anything to the contrary in this Agreement, the Company may effect any Underwritten Offering pursuant to any then-effective Registration Statement, including a Form S-3, that is then available for such offering.

  • Piggyback Underwritten Offerings In the case of a registration pursuant to Section 2.2 which involves an underwritten offering, the Company shall enter into an underwriting agreement in connection therewith and all of the Participating Holders’ Registrable Securities to be included in such registration shall be subject to such underwriting agreement. Any Participating Holder may, at its option, require that any or all of the representations and warranties by, and the other agreements on the part of, the Company to and for the benefit of such underwriters shall also be made to and for the benefit of such Participating Holder and that any or all of the conditions precedent to the obligations of such underwriters under such underwriting agreement be conditions precedent to the obligations of such Participating Holder; provided, however, that the Company shall not be required to make any representations or warranties with respect to written information specifically provided by a Participating Holder for inclusion in the registration statement. Each such Participating Holder shall not be required to make any representations or warranties to or agreements with the Company or the underwriters other than representations, warranties or agreements regarding such Participating Holder, its ownership of and title to the Registrable Securities, any written information specifically provided by such Participating Holder for inclusion in the registration statement and its intended method of distribution; and any liability of such Participating Holder to any underwriter or other Person under such underwriting agreement shall be limited to the amount of the net proceeds received by such Participating Holder upon the sale of the Registrable Securities pursuant to the registration statement and shall be limited to liability for written information specifically provided by such Participating Holder.

  • Underwritten Offerings If the Company at any time proposes to register any of its securities under the Securities Act, as contemplated by Section 8 hereof, and such securities are to be distributed by or through one or more underwriters, the Company will, if requested by any Holder of Option Securities as provided in Section 8.1 and subject to the provisions of this Section 8.4, arrange for such underwriters to include all of the Option Securities to be offered and sold by such holder among the securities to be distributed by such underwriters. In the event that the managing underwriter of any underwritten offering informs the Company and the Holder or Holders of Option Securities requesting the inclusion of their securities in such offering in writing of its belief that the number of securities requested to be sold in such offering exceeds the number which can be sold in such offering, then the Company will include in such offering only securities proposed to be sold by Company for its own account and decrease the number of Option Securities so proposed to be sold and requested to be included in such offering (pro rata on the basis of the percentage of the securities, by number of shares, of the Company requested to be included in the offering by the Holder or Holders of such Option Securities and all other holders of the Company's securities proposing to include shares in such offering) to the extent necessary to reduce the number of securities to be included in such offering to the level recommended by the managing underwriter. The holder or holders of Option Securities to be distributed by such underwriters shall be parties to the underwriting agreement between the Company and such underwriters and any necessary or appropriate customary agreements, shall execute appropriate powers of attorney, and may at their option, require that any or all of the representations and warranties by, and the other agreements on the part of, the Company to and for the benefit of such underwriters shall also be made to and for the benefit of such Holder or Holders of Option Securities and that any or all of the conditions precedent to the obligations of such underwriters under such underwriting agreement be conditions precedent to the obligations of such Holder or Holders of Option Securities. Any such Holder of Option Securities shall not be required to make any representations or warranties to or agreement with the Company or the underwriters other than representatives, warranties and agreements regarding such Holder, such Holder's Option Securities and such holder's intended method of distribution and any other representation required by law.

  • Shelf Takedown At any time and from time to time following the effectiveness of the shelf registration statement required by subsection 2.1.1 or 2.1.2, any Holder(s) may request to sell all or a portion of their Registrable Securities in an Underwritten Offering that is registered pursuant to such shelf registration statement (a “Shelf Underwritten Offering”) provided that such Holder(s) (a) reasonably expect aggregate gross proceeds in excess of $50,000,000 from such Shelf Underwritten Offering or (b) reasonably expects to sell all of the Registrable Securities held by such Holder in such Shelf Underwritten Offering but in no event for less than $10,000,000 in aggregate gross proceeds. All requests for a Shelf Underwritten Offering shall be made by giving written notice to the Company (the “Shelf Takedown Notice”). Each Shelf Takedown Notice shall specify the approximate number of Registrable Securities proposed to be sold in the Shelf Underwritten Offering and the expected price range (net of underwriting discounts and commissions) of such Shelf Underwritten Offering. Within five (5) business days after receipt of any Shelf Takedown Notice, the Company shall give written notice of such requested Shelf Underwritten Offering to all other Holders of Registrable Securities (the “Company Shelf Takedown Notice”) and, subject to reductions consistent with the Pro Rata calculations in subsection 2.2.4, shall include in such Shelf Underwritten Offering all Registrable Securities with respect to which the Company has received written requests for inclusion therein, within five (5) days after sending the Company Shelf Takedown Notice. The Company shall enter into an underwriting agreement in a form as is customary in Underwritten Offerings of securities by the Company with the managing Underwriter or Underwriters selected by the initiating Holder(s) after consultation with the Company and shall take all such other reasonable actions as are requested by the managing Underwriter or Underwriters in order to expedite or facilitate the disposition of such Registrable Securities. In connection with any Shelf Underwritten Offering contemplated by this subsection 2.1.3, subject to Section 3.4 and Article IV, the underwriting agreement into which each Holder and the Company shall enter shall contain such representations, covenants, indemnities and other rights and obligations of the Company and the selling stockholders as are customary in Underwritten Offerings of securities by the Company.
